Guys plz tell me your opinion. I have a 636 2003 with 75000 kms... bought it very cheap,but previous owner didn't have a service book or something. Bike runs really good,no oil or antifreeze burning and idles good. I can hear a big ticking sound from the head when cruising around 4k rpms or when decelerating. I checked valve tappet clearance and it was within specs, check the chain tensioner and was good,also checked the cams surface,it looks good too. I know Kawasaki makes some noisy engines but i think it's too much. Ticking sound started to sound more and more as the weather became too cold,I'm currently on 10-40 full synthetic IPONE with 4000kms (gonna change oil and filter next week)
UPDATE if anyone is wondering or something :P timing chain was shot, needed replacement (was too lose and cam timing was set of) Switched to mechanical chain tensioner Crankshaft journal bearings were destroyed Con rods journal bearings were destroyed too Replaced them all Fixed issues with 2nd gear and repair forks,also new gearbox axle bearing. Repair fuel pump and reprogram PC3 Total cost 1400€
